Minister says government will provide development

Akosombo, May 24, GNA – Dr Kwasi Akyem Apea-Kubi, the Eastern Regional Minister, has assured the chiefs and people of Akwamu Traditional Area that the government was committed to providing them with development projects.

“I want to assure Nananom of government’s commitment to ensure that Akwamuman and for that matter Asuogyaman gets its fair share of the national cake,” he said.

Dr Apea-Kubi said this at a durbar of chiefs and people of Akwamu Traditional Area at Akwamufie over the weekend as part of his tour of the area.

Dr Apea-Kubi said since the assumption of office by the National Democratic Congress (NDC) government, a lot of development projects had been initiated throughout the country.

He said the Asuogyaman District had benefited from school buildings, health facilities, road and others and that more would be added to them. Dr Apea-Kubi attended similar durbars Boso Gua and Anum Traditional Areas.

Earlier Dr Apea-Kubi inspected a number of ongoing projects in the district and these included two three-storey 18-unit classroom block at the Presbyterian Senior High School (SHS) at Boso, a 12-unit classroom block at Anum Presbyterian SHS all funded by the Ghana Education Trust Fund.
